Tại sao St Joseph Cathedral lại là địa điểm chụp ảnh áo dài lý tưởng? (Why Is St Joseph Cathedral Ideal for Ao Dai Photography?)

The cathedral's soaring ceiling and cream-colored stone create soft, even light indoors without harsh shadows. Rose windows cast colored light onto skin and fabric—especially mid-morning (8–10 AM) when east-facing stained glass glows. The wooden pews, high altar steps, and stone columns provide depth and layering, so your ao dai silhouette stands out against busy architectural detail. Exterior forecourt shots offer symmetry; interior side chapels offer intimate, lit corners. Few travelers book cathedral sessions early, so you'll find quiet spaces if you arrive by 8 AM. The space feels respectful and timeless—ao dai photographs here age well because the aesthetic never dates.

What Light and Time of Day Works Best Inside and Outside?

Interior light: Early morning (7–8:30 AM) gives soft, directional light from east-facing rose windows—ideal for close-ups and face detail. By 10 AM, light moves high and loses modeling; by noon, interior becomes dim and flat. Avoid midday (12–2 PM). Late afternoon (4–5 PM) works if you want warm golden tones on the west side, but exterior crowds peak then.

Exterior (forecourt): Shoot before 10 AM for cool, even light. Late afternoon (5–6 PM) offers dramatic side-lit golden hour, but crowds build. Cloudy mornings provide soft, flattering light with no squint.

Dress Code & Ao Dai Fabric Choices for a Sacred Space

Inside St Joseph Cathedral, modest dress is required. Your ao dai covers your shoulders, torso, and legs by design, but check these details before booking:

  • Neckline: Keep collars high or add a sheer overlay if your áo dài sits low. No exposed cleavage.
  • Sleeves: Full or three-quarter sleeves preferred. Sleeveless áo dài must pair with a lightweight tunic or vest worn indoors.
  • Hemline: Full-length áo dài is standard; café culottes (cropped legs) read casual and may feel less reverent.
  • Fabric weight: Hanoi summer (April–October) is 28–35°C. Silk crepe, cotton voile, or linen-blend áo dài breathe better than heavy brocade. You'll be standing in a non-climate-controlled space for 60–90 minutes; lighter fabric means you stay composed and sweat doesn't show on camera.
  • Color: Jewel tones (emerald, sapphire, burgundy) pop against stone. Whites and pastels risk overexposure near windows. Deep reds and blacks photograph richly.
  • Layers: A simple silk scarf or stole (kăn khăn) adds visual interest and covers shoulders if needed for particularly strict dress-code moments.

Avoid: Polyester-heavy fabrics (they cling to skin and show sweat). Avoid ultra-shiny silk taffeta (window light creates blown-out spots on chest/shoulders).

Cathedral Etiquette, Permit Rules & When to Book

Entrance & prayer times: St Joseph Cathedral is active 24/7 for worship. Early morning (before 8 AM) is least crowded. Avoid booking during Mass times—weekday Masses are roughly 6:15 AM and 5 PM; Sunday Masses from 7 AM onward (full schedule at the cathedral office). Dos and don'ts:

  • Do remove shoes if entering the main sanctuary beyond the nave (often the side chapels allow shoes).
  • Do keep voices low and phone on silent.
  • Don't touch altar candles, flowers, or religious items.
  • Don't walk in front of the altar during active worship.
  • Do offer a small donation ($2–5 USD or 50,000 VND) to the poor box if you use the main altar steps for photos; it's respectful and helps the cathedral's upkeep.

Best booking window: Early season (November–March) = cooler temps, fewer tourists, longer morning light. Book 1–2 weeks ahead. Peak summer (May–August) is very hot and humid; book 3 weeks ahead if your heart is set on the cathedral. Late September–October is shoulder season—excellent light, moderate crowds.

ฉันควรสวมใส่อะไรภายใต้áo dài เมื่อถ่ายภาพในโบสถ์? (What do I wear under an ao dai for cathedral shoots?)

Wear smooth, breathable undergarments (thin cotton or microfiber) that won't bunch or show panty lines under silk. Avoid bras with thick straps unless your ao dai covers shoulders fully. High-waisted briefs sit flush under the high-waist áo dài fit. In summer heat, moisture-wicking fabric (bamboo, synthetic blend) prevents sweat marks.
